Submitting Your Fire Insurance Claim: A Comprehensive Guide

Experiencing a fire in your home can be a devastating event. Thankfully, fire insurance exists to help you recover from the damage and rebuild your life. Filing a fire insurance claim can seem overwhelming, but by following these straightforward steps, you can make the process smoother and more efficient.

  • First Notify Your Insurance Company: Report the fire to your insurance provider as soon as possible after the incident. Provide them with all necessary details about the fire, including the date, time, and location.
  • Document the Damage: Before cleaning or making any repairs, thoroughly document the damage caused by the fire using photographs and videos. This visual evidence will be crucial when submitting your claim.
  • Make a Detailed Inventory: List all damaged or destroyed items, including descriptions, purchase dates, and estimated values. Receipts and appraisals can help substantiate these claims.
  • Work with the Insurance Adjuster: An insurance adjuster will be assigned to your claim to assess the damage and determine the amount of compensation you are entitled to. Be forthcoming and provide them with all requested information.
  • Present Your Claim Documentation: Once you have gathered all necessary documentation, submit it to your insurance company as instructed. This typically involves filling out claim forms and providing supporting evidence.

Keep Records of All Communications: Keep detailed records of all communications with your insurance company, including phone calls, emails, and letters. This documentation can be helpful if any disputes arise.

Grasping Your Fire Insurance Coverage: What to Expect

Having fire insurance is a essential step in protecting your assets. However, navigating the complexities of your policy can be challenging. It's vital to understand what your coverage provides so you can feel confident in the event of a fire. Your fire insurance policy will typically specify the scope of your coverage against fire-related harm. This includes physical damage to your residence, as well as personal property inside.

It's also essential to examine the limitations of your policy. These are specific circumstances that may not be covered by your insurance. Some typical exclusions include damage caused by storms, earthquakes, or malicious acts.
